Why Image Optimization Matters
Before diving into the techniques for image optimization, let’s understand why it is so important for your website’s performance.
1. Faster Loading Times
The speed at which your website loads is a critical factor in user satisfaction. Research has shown that users expect a webpage to load in just a few seconds, and if it takes too long, they are likely to bounce off to another site. Large and unoptimized images are one of the primary culprits behind slow loading times. By optimizing your images, you can significantly reduce the time it takes for your webpages to load, resulting in a better user experience.
2. Improved SEO
Search engines like Google consider page speed as a ranking factor. Websites that load quickly tend to rank higher in search results. Image optimization can directly impact your website’s SEO by enhancing its loading speed. This, in turn, can lead to increased organic traffic and better search engine rankings.
3. Reduced Bandwidth Usage
Unoptimized images can consume a significant amount of bandwidth, especially for mobile users who may have limited data plans. By optimizing your images, you can reduce the amount of data transferred when a user accesses your website, saving both their bandwidth and your hosting costs.
4. Enhanced User Experience
A fast-loading website contributes to a better overall user experience. When users can quickly access the content they’re looking for, they are more likely to stay on your site, engage with your content, and convert into customers or subscribers.

Techniques for Image Optimization
1. Choose the Right Image Format (JPEG, PNG, WebP)
The choice of image format can significantly impact the size and quality of an image. There are several common image formats, but three of the most widely used ones are JPEG, PNG, and WebP. Each format has its strengths and weaknesses, and choosing the right one depends on the type of image and its intended use.
- JPEG: This format is ideal for photographs and images with a wide range of colors. It uses lossy compression, which means some quality is sacrificed for smaller file sizes. You can adjust the compression level to find a balance between image quality and file size.
- PNG: PNG is a lossless compression format that preserves image quality but results in larger file sizes. It’s best suited for images with transparency or those that require high detail and sharpness, such as logos and graphics.
- WebP: WebP is a modern image format developed by Google. It offers both lossless and lossy compression and often produces smaller file sizes compared to JPEG and PNG while maintaining good image quality. WebP is supported by most modern browsers.
When choosing an image format, consider the specific requirements of your website and the content you are displaying. Experiment with different formats to find the one that strikes the right balance between image quality and file size.
2. Resize Images for Web
Another essential aspect of image optimization is resizing images to fit the dimensions of your webpages. Uploading large images and relying on the browser to resize them can slow down your website’s loading speed. Instead, you should resize images to their display dimensions before uploading them.
For example, if your website’s blog post content area has a maximum width of 800 pixels, there’s no need to upload images that are 4000 pixels wide. You can use image editing software or online tools to resize images to the appropriate dimensions.
3. Compress Images
Image compression is the process of reducing the file size of images without significantly compromising their quality. There are two types of image compression: lossless and lossy.
- Lossless Compression: Lossless compression reduces the file size without any loss of image quality. It’s ideal for images that need to maintain the highest level of detail and clarity, such as product photos or illustrations. Tools like Adobe Photoshop and online services like TinyPNG offer lossless compression.
- Lossy Compression: Lossy compression reduces file sizes by sacrificing some image quality. The degree of compression can be adjusted to control the balance between quality and file size. This is suitable for photographs and images where a slight loss of quality is acceptable. Popular tools for lossy compression include JPEGoptim and ImageOptim.
Experiment with different compression settings to find the right balance for your images. Keep in mind that excessive compression can result in visible artifacts, so it’s essential to strike a balance that maintains acceptable image quality.
4. Enable Browser Caching
Browser caching is a technique that allows web browsers to store certain files, including images, on a user’s device after they visit your website for the first time. This means that when the user navigates to another page on your site or returns to it later, the browser can load cached files instead of downloading them again. Enabling browser caching can significantly reduce load times for returning visitors.
To enable browser caching, you’ll need to add appropriate HTTP headers to your server’s configuration. Many content management systems (CMS), such as WordPress, have plugins or settings that make it easy to configure browser caching.
5. Use Lazy Loading
Lazy loading is a technique that defers the loading of off-screen images until the user scrolls down to view them. This can dramatically improve initial page load times, as the browser doesn’t need to download and render all images at once.
Most modern web development frameworks and CMS platforms offer built-in support for lazy loading. You can also implement lazy loading manually using JavaScript. By using this technique, you ensure that images are loaded only when they are needed, reducing the initial page load time and saving bandwidth.
6. Implement Image Compression Plugins
If you’re using a CMS like WordPress, there are many image optimization plugins available that can automate the image optimization process. These plugins can handle tasks such as image compression, resizing, and lazy loading.
Some popular image optimization plugins for WordPress include:
- Smush: Smush is a widely used image optimization plugin that offers both lossless and lossy compression. It can automatically compress and resize images as you upload them to your WordPress media library.
- ShortPixel: ShortPixel is another powerful image optimization plugin that can compress images in various formats, including JPEG, PNG, and WebP. It also supports lazy loading and WebP conversion.
- Imagify: Imagify is a user-friendly image optimization plugin that offers three levels of compression: normal, aggressive, and ultra. It can also convert images to WebP format and supports lazy loading.
Installing and configuring one of these plugins can streamline your image optimization process and ensure that your website’s images are always optimized for performance.
7. Optimize Images for Mobile Devices
With the increasing use of smartphones and tablets for browsing the web, it’s crucial to optimize your images for mobile devices. Mobile-optimized images are typically smaller in size, which reduces both load times and data usage for mobile users.
To optimize images for mobile, consider the following:
- Use responsive design: Ensure that your website design adapts to different screen sizes and orientations. This will prevent unnecessarily large images from being loaded on mobile devices.
- Serve different image sizes: Implement the
srcsetattribute in your HTML to specify multiple image sizes for different screen resolutions. This allows the browser to select the appropriate image based on the user’s device. - Test on mobile devices: Regularly test your website on various mobile devices to ensure that images load quickly and look good on small screens.
8. Optimize Image Delivery with Content Delivery Networks (CDNs)
Content Delivery Networks (CDNs) are a network of distributed servers that cache and deliver content, including images, to users based on their geographic location. By using a CDN, you can reduce the physical distance between your website’s server and your users, which can lead to faster image delivery and improved load times.
Many CDNs offer image optimization features, such as automatic image compression and format conversion. They can also help offload the delivery of images from your web server, reducing the server’s workload and improving overall performance.
Some popular CDNs with image optimization capabilities include Cloudflare, Amazon CloudFront, and Akamai. These services typically offer easy integration with popular CMS platforms and provide tools to help you configure image optimization settings.
